Ear infections are quite common in Yorkies and may be caused by excessive water in the ear or excessive humidity in the air. Keep an eye out for these issues, and plan regular ear cleansings to avoid them.
Like other small breeds, Yorkshire Terriers are prone to mouth and dental problems. Their smaller mouths can have overcrowding, which can trap food particles, bacteria, and minerals between the teeth. This can cause gum disease and lead to adult tooth loss if not addressed. You should brush your Clovis yorkshire terrier kaufen Terrier's teeth regularly and take them to the vet for regular dental cleanings.

Yorkies like all breeds of dogs are susceptible to certain health problems. Regular veterinary care can reduce the chance of developing these diseases.
The painful degenerative hip condition Legg-Calve-Perthes is more common in young Yorkies. This is a condition that occurs when there is not enough blood flowing to the femoral heads, situated at the tops of the thighs. This can result in pain, inflammation, and lameness in either of the rear legs.
Another problem that is commonly encountered in Yorkshire Terriers is tracheal collapsing that occurs when the ring of cartilage that forms the trachea flattens. It can be caused by trauma or illness, as well as wear and tear from age. It can cause breathing difficulties, coughing and wheezing. If not treated immediately it could lead to death.
